Paracoccidioidomycosis in Colombia: an ecological study

Summary
The natural habitat of Paracoccidioides brasiliensis, the cause of paracoccidioidomycosis (PCM), was identified. Specific ecological factors like altitude, rainfall, humid forests, and crops such as coffee and tobacco are associated with PCM incidence in Colombian municipalities.

Background:
- The ecological niche of Paracoccidioides brasiliensis, the causative agent of paracoccidioidomycosis (PCM), is not well-defined.
- Understanding the environmental reservoirs of P. brasiliensis is crucial for controlling PCM transmission.
Purpose of the Study:
- To investigate the association between ecological variables in Colombian municipalities and the incidence of PCM.
- To identify potential natural habitats and risk factors for P. brasiliensis exposure.
Main Methods:
- A multivariate analysis was performed on data from 940 PCM patients across 216 Colombian municipalities.
- Ecological variables including altitude, rainfall, forest type, and agricultural crops were analyzed.
- Incidence Rate Ratios (IRR) were calculated for municipalities with available patient data.
Main Results:
- Altitude between 1,000-1,499 meters (IRR=6.37), rainfall of 2000-2999 mm (IRR=2.15), humid forests (IRR=1.79), coffee cultivation (IRR=1.95), and tobacco cultivation (IRR=3.59) were significantly associated with higher PCM incidence.
- These factors collectively indicate potential reservareas for P. brasiliensis.
Conclusions:
- Specific environmental and agricultural conditions in certain Colombian municipalities are linked to increased PCM risk.
- These findings help pinpoint potential habitats for P. brasiliensis, aiding in public health strategies for PCM prevention.
